Cardiopulmonary Specialist (On-Call)
Job description
Summary:
Under limited supervision, coordinates cardiopulmonary care for Samuel Simmonds Memorial Hospital patients. This position supports cardiac, pulmonary, and sleep medicine services through care coordination and direct patient care.
The following duties are intended to provide a representative summary of the major duties and responsibilities and ARE NOT intended to serve as a comprehensive list of all duties performed by all employees in this classification. Incumbent(s) may not be required to perform all duties listed and may be required to perform additional, position-specific duties.
Essential Job Functions:
- Coordinates care for patients requiring cardiopulmonary and sleep medicine services.
- Conducts pulmonary function tests.
- Assists Providers in procedures, e.g., bronchoscopies, transesophageal echocardiograms, and cardiac stress tests.
- Administers respiratory treatment in various modalities for acute and chronic respiratory illness as prescribed by the medical staff for neonate, pediatric, adolescent and adult patients.
- Ensures delivery of clinically appropriate respiratory care procedures. Instructs orients and recommends respiratory care and procedures to medical staff and allied health professionals.
- Mechanical Ventilation and oxygen support systems: Perform set-up, monitoring, assessment of equipment/pt. interface and makes appropriate changes. Recognizes abnormal changes and immediately notifies the responsible Provider.
- Maintains secure and patent airways and performs nasal, nasotracheal, endotracheal and oral suctioning.
- Distributes completed test results to Providers.
- Maintains patient charts, enters diagnostic information, logs data into patient information systems, and updates file systems for tests and treatments performed.
- Provides patient education and instruction, answers questions, and explains procedures.
- Performs other duties as assigned.
Qualification:
Five (5) years of Respiratory Therapy or Cardiopulmonary experience required.
Three (3) years of intra-op assistance experience with Cardiology and Pulmonology procedures.
Education & Experience:
Must be registered or registry eligible by the National Board of Respiratory Care (NBRC). Registry eligibility includes:
- 18 years old AND
- Hold a minimum of an associate degree from a respiratory therapy education program supported or accredited by the Commission on Accreditation for Respiratory Care (CoARC). OR
- Be a Certified Respiratory Therapist (CRT) for at least four years prior to examination for RRT certification and have 62 college credits. OR
- Be a CRT for at least two years prior to RRT examination and have a minimum of an associate degree from an accredited entry-level respiratory care education program. OR
- Be a CRT for at least two years prior to RRT examination and hold a baccalaureate degree in an area other than respiratory care and have at least 62 college credits from an accredited program.
- Experience in assisting with bronchoscopies, echocardiograms, loop recorder insertions, and similar procedures required.
- Experience in performing pulmonary function tests required.
